Moscow, October 5, 2009

DuPont presented modern architectural and construction solutions based on innovation in Chelyabinsk

DuPont held the workshop "Modern Architectural and Construction Solutions: Safety, Durability, Energy Efficiency, Comfort" in Chelyabinsk, Russian Federation.
The workshop was run jointly with Chelyabinsk Plant of Modern Glass. The attendees were architects, designers, representatives of facade design companies. Experts from DuPont presented best practices in construction of residential and public buildings, innovative materials improving energy efficiency, safety and sustainability of facilities.
As an innovation-driven company DuPont annually invests over $1.3 bln in research and development in order to deliver new materials with unique properties.
DuPont has gained extensive expertise in the construction of modern buildings and facilities in many countries. DuPont materials provide safety and esthetics, are durable and energy effective. Hence, DuPont materials are used worldwide in construction of the most advanced facilities.
The workshop showcased the following architectural materials by DuPont: safe decorative glass (SentryGlas® Expressions), unique technologies (SentryGlas® and Spallshield®), and multi-purpose architectural materials for creating perfect surfaces (Corian® and Zodiaq®) and non-woven membranes (DuPont™ Tyvek® and DuPont™ Typar®). 

"Laminated glass featuring SentryGlas technology does not only profide safety but also helps reduce the weight of an entire building and make it more cost-effective," observes Dr.Boris Ukhov, Eastern Europe SentryGlass.

"Use of DuPont™ Tyvek® hydro/windproof membranes can also contribute to improving energy efficiency." "According to recent research, installation of DuPont™ Tyvek insulating coats can improve energy efficiency up to 40%.  These materials also enhance the durability of structural elements and heat insulation, which results in lower cost of building maintenance," said Yevgeny Severin, Tyvek ®, Typar ® membranes and Corian ®, Montelli ® Solid Surface Buiding Innovations Representative in the Siberia and Ural Regions.
